The AI market in India shows strong indications of continuous growth. Market analysts project that the value will exceed $6.3 billion in 2024. The rapid advancement of AI in India will continue according to market projections, which show a $17 billion market by 2027 with compound annual growth rates (CAGR) between 25% and 35%. This predicted explosion demonstrates the growing adoption of AI technology in India.
India operates actively for the development of AI systems through strategic government initiatives. In 2018, the government established the National Strategy for Artificial Intelligence. It developed the AI for India 2030 initiative to integrate AI across national socio-economic structures and generate potential economic contributions of up to $500 billion.
The country of India has an extensive pool of capable employees. The country benefits from over 5 million programmers to develop AI systems as its population of under 30-year-olds leads to rapid digital technology acceptance.
Various companies across India are swiftly adopting Artificial Intelligence capabilities. The recent survey reveals India AI powerhouse leads all other countries with 59% adopters of artificial intelligence in their companies. This widespread deployment demonstrates India's willingness to integrate AI across business industries.
The technological industry worldwide sees significant potential in AI applications throughout India. Microsoft invested $3 billion in building its Azure cloud and AI capabilities in India, which created a dual benefit: strengthening infrastructure and delivering training to many citizens to develop a strong AI community.
